Established in 1981, Patton, Moreno & Asvat is ranked amongst the five more important law firms in Panama. It is also characterized as a Firm that offers legal services of the highest quality is truly committed to its clients around the world.
Patton, Moreno & Asvat has consolidated its successful reputation not only in the Republic of Panama, but also in other countries around the world where the Firm has an important presence.
Our vision is to develop new businesses and to offer an integrated legal counseling, oriented to the establishment, promotion and development of international business relationships. The Firm has offices in Bahamas, Belize, British Virgin Islands, London and Uruguay.
Our staff of lawyers has achieved graduate, post graduate, masters and doctor’s degrees in well recognized universities such as, Duke University, Tulane University, Harvard University, Boston University, University of Pennsylvania, Cardiff University and Fordham University, among others.
Our law firm is associated to important national and international associations such as: Panama Bar Association, International Bar Association, Inter-American Bar Association, New York Bar Association, Louisiana State Bar Association, Association of International Lawyers, Fiscal International Association, Panama-British Business Association, Panamanian Association of Maritime Law, Capital State Law Firm Group, L2B Group Chamber of Commerce, Industries and Agriculture of Panama, American Chamber of Commerce & Industry of Panama, Bureau of Convention and Visitors of Panama.
